Waldo is a watercolor and acrylic painting done over vintage letters and envelops from the 1950's. The handwriting and stamps can be seen under the watercolor paint around the edges.

I am intrigued by the passage of time, the varied experience of memories and childhood curiosity. The perception of these themes depends on our point of view. I challenge the normal point of view by combining fantastical elements with the ordinary and finding beauty in age and decay. Thus showing that with a little imagination our everyday experiences can include fantasy and whimsy. And maybe if only for a few minutes we can see the world with both child like curiosity and adult philosophical reflection. I find inspiration everywhere. Nature, literature, or a single word can spark an idea. Sometimes it is a vision of the completed piece sometimes merely a central idea to be developed as I work. One thing is consistent however, I always begin my work with a flash of inspiration, and end it when I believe I have captured the fleeting idea so it can be experienced again and again. My current body of work is mixed media paintings done over vintage love letters, recipe cards and paperwork. I layer whimsical subject matter over tangible representations of human relationships. The whimsy creates moments of joy and stress relieving smiles, thus allowing for a pause in which to experience the heart, soul and human connections embodied in the vintage backgrounds. Juxtaposing whimsy with textural reality creates surprise, wonder, and a need to look closer.
